Re: All the things uTorrent can do that Transmission can't
in the info dictionary of a torrent file of more than one file, the value of the key "4:name" is the name of the directory that will contain all files, with optional relative paths, in the files list (the list after "5:files"). if the torrent only has information about one file, then the name is the ...
